Hi all,
Not sure where's the best place to ask... The question is: is there any way to change school of another race. For example I'm Caldari having industry career but I want to play on Gallente's side and change my career to Gallente industrial and follow Gallente's storline missions. What should I start with? I don't want to recreate my character, this is exactly what I wanted, have character of one race but play on another's side.
Thanks.

Originally by: Daerhiel What should I start with? I don't want to recreate my character, this is exactly what I wanted, have character of one race but play on another's side.
Thanks.
Open up the people and places interface and type in gallente to the search. under the member corporations list you will see a list of corporations. if you select one of theese corps you should look in the agents tab. it will list agents available to you. choose one then fly to his location and get talking.
you might what to start in the starter system for gallente and go through their tutorial as it will escalate you into the mission system for gallente. Sinq Liason, Essence are 2 empire based Gallente regions which should have the majority of gallente agents. I dont know gallente that much but im sure someone will direct you if you head towards those regions.

One thing to note, although you can mission for Gallente all you like, any NPC corps you are in are decided by your character creation, you won't be able to join a Gallente NPC corp like the scope or one of the schools.
Exception to the rule of course is the Gallente faction warefare npc corp which you can join when you get enough standing.

Originally by: Daerhiel There's a corp and there's a school. What is a school for then?
I think the different schools are simply following the roleplay and perhaps more importantly they enable a character to be located in the correct racial space where you will find agents of that race. There is not much else of use IMO about the schools. The tutorials are the same as far as I know.
"School" is somewhat of a misnomer since most players seem to learn more from other more experienced players. Which is one good reason for joining an active player corp instead of remaining in the school starter corp.

If you're new, run the following arcs listed by value (Business/Military/Industry). Run the 2 missions for the Tutorial agent, then the arc from the Event agent in the only station in these systems.
Amarr: Conoban, Deepari, Pasha Caldari: Jouvulen, Uitra, Todaki Gallente: Trossere, Couster, Clellinon Minmatar: Embod, Hadaugago, Malukker
